The latest version of MSI App Player (often based on BlueStacks 5 or newer) is optimized for Windows 10/11 with virtualization support. However, if you are running Windows 7, 8, or an older laptop with 4GB of RAM, newer versions may lag, stutter, or fail to install altogether. Older versions (e.g., v4.x or early v5.x) have lighter system footprints.

Before installing an older build, completely remove your current MSI App Player. Use the Windows Control Panel or a dedicated uninstaller tool to wipe remaining cache files, preventing file conflicts.
